(a)The Commission consists of 21 members appointed by the Governor with the advice and consent of the Senate.
(b)The members shall:
(1)to the extent practicable, be members of the LGBTQIA+ community;
(2)include at least two transgender individuals;
(3)to the extent practicable, reflect the age, gender, gender identity or expression, ancestral, national origin, color, disability, religious, sex, sexual orientation, racial, ethnic, socioeconomic, and geographic diversity of the State;
(4)know about issues facing LGBTQIA+ communities and be sensitive to the problems of LGBTQIA+ communities;
